Mobile-First Platform Expectations

The dominant trend reshaping digital product design and deployment is mobile-first thinking. More users now initiate interactions from mobile devices than desktop computers. According to Statista, global mobile traffic accounts for over 55% of web traffic, pushing platforms toward prioritizing the mobile experience.

Mobile-first is not just about designing smaller screens; it demands a fundamental rethink of how information is structured, how interactions happen, and how performance is optimized. For instance, companies like FinancialContent — delivering real-time market news and data — must ensure that their content loads swiftly and is easy to read and navigate on smartphones.

  • Minimal latency: Mobile networks and devices can be slower and less reliable than desktops, so platforms optimize load times and reduce data usage.
  • Touch-friendly UI: Controls need to respond intuitively to finger taps and gestures, requiring iterative UX improvements.
  • Context-awareness: Platforms tailor content based on location, device capabilities, and user preferences.

Continuous product iteration helps address these mobile-first needs by collecting real-world usage data, analyzing performance metrics, and releasing frequent updates. Cloud Infrastructure and Scalability

Scalability is the backbone of any platform aiming to serve diverse devices and fluctuating traffic volumes. Cloud-based infrastructure provides the elasticity and global reach necessary to support continuous product iteration and multi-device support.

Companies like FinancialContent, GlobePRwire, and CloudQuote APIs rely on cloud providers to deploy their backend services, data storage, and content delivery networks (CDNs). This infrastructure enables:

Benefit Explanation Impact on Continuous Improvement Elastic resources Automatically scale server instances up or down based on demand Supports high traffic during peak hours without degradation Geographically distributed data centers Serve content closer to users worldwide Reduces latency, improving load times and user satisfaction Faster deployment cycles Use containerization and CI/CD pipelines on cloud platforms Enables rapid feature releases and bug fixes across devices Cost efficiency Pay-as-you-go pricing models Make ongoing iterations sustainable even at scale

Without cloud infrastructure, platforms would struggle to maintain performance consistency and rapid release cadences demanded by modern multi-device users.

Performance and Fast Loading

Performance is a critical competitive advantage for any platform. Studies show that even a one-second delay in load time can dramatically increase bounce rates and reduce user satisfaction.

Continuous improvement includes rigorous performance monitoring and optimization to meet the criteria of fast loading times and smooth interactions. This is especially true for data-driven platforms like FinancialContent and CloudQuote APIs where up-to-date, accurate financial information must appear instantly.

Key performance strategies include:

  • Efficient API design: Secure APIs that minimize payload sizes and support caching.
  • Content Delivery Networks (CDNs): Distribute static and dynamic assets close to users globally.
  • Lazy loading: Defer loading offscreen content until needed.
  • Optimized front-end assets: Minified JavaScript, compressed images, and streamlined CSS.

Iterative product updates involve analyzing performance bottlenecks from real user telemetry and synthetic tests on multiple devices and networks. This data-driven approach allows teams to continuously iterate and enhance platform speed and reliability.
